
About Unni Menon
Unni Menon was born on August 12, 1957 at Guruvayoor, a temple town in the Thrissur district of Kerala. He attended the Government Victoria College, Palakkad from where he graduated with a degree in Physics. Unni Menon moved to Chennai (then Madras) where he had a job in the Heavy Vehicles Factory at Avadi. Many of the prominent recording studios of South India were located in Chennai.
